Define a project. What are five characteristics that help differentiate projects from other functions carried out in the daily o
vladimir2022 [97]

Answer:

A project is a combination of tasks that need to be finished to reach a specific, bigger goal. Since project tasks are not to be confused with the daily schedule of work, this is what differentiates a project from the routine tasks:

- <em>defined span</em> - while daily tasks are usually continuous by nature, project tasks are set in a specific time frame

- <em>project life cycle</em> - similar to the life cycle of a product, a project follows a similar curve that symbolizes the birth of the project, its maturity stage and its decline

- <em>defined goal/objective</em> - the completion of a project and its tasks has to be indicated by reaching a specific goal

- <em>cross-department teams </em>- project teams usually involve people from more business departments (marketing, HR, R&D...)

- <em>allocated resources</em> - while daily, continuous tasks usually source resources (financial, human...) from the firm directly, a project usually has a specifically assigned amount of allocated resources

Hibshman Corporation bases its predetermined overhead rate on the estimated machine-hours for the upcoming year. At the beginnin
lesya692 [45]

Answer:

total predetermined overhead rate = $29.84 per machine hours

so correct option is C) $29.84 per machine-hour

Explanation:

given data

machine hours = 10,000

variable manufacturing overhead = $6.82

fixed manufacturing overhead = $230,200

to find out

predetermined overhead rate

solution

we know that here variable  manufacturing overhead so

estimated fixed overhead rate will be

estimated fixed overhead rate = \frac{230200}{10000}

estimated fixed overhead rate = $23.02 per machine hour

and

total predetermined overhead rate is here

total predetermined overhead rate = $6.82 + $23.02

total predetermined overhead rate = $29.84 per machine hours

so correct option is C) $29.84 per machine-hour
